Leather sofas will see you into summer

Leather sofas are set to make a return for next year – so if you want to be ahead on the interiors game, it might be worth investing in one now.
The luxurious material has dominated the recent Fashion Weeks in New York and London.
When a material appears on the catwalk, it is sure to feature in interiors – especially now that many designers have an eye on both fashion and the home.
According to Australian style guide Wangle, high streets are likely to be dominated by leather shorts and other items that might require a little daring.
Perspicacious homeowners should take a few tips from the catwalk and transfer them to the hallway.
Wangle's experts suggest opting for "muted" colours which are a little bit classier and can add a bit more "polish" to the material.
This rules out Miami Vice interiors. It's best to opt for classic leather designs which look better with age, so Chesterfields are in and sagging white sofas are out.

Cleaning show 2011 @ NEC

Cleaning Show is a showcase for all products and services used in the cleaning and support services industry.

It is the UK’s only major event where companies can market, sell and promote their products and services to an international audience. The exhibition is organised every two years on behalf of the cleaning industry by BCCE Ltd, a company jointly owned by the British Cleaning Council and Quartz Publishing & Exhibitions.

Are carpets back in vogue?

Interior design trends are always changing, but if there’s one that’s stuck around for a good few years, its wood flooring decorated with the odd rug.

However, it seems that the tide is turning against this particular style of flooring, as one interior designer says that Britons are now flocking back to wall-to-wall carpeting.

Designers say that wall-to-wall carpeting has not really been in vogue for about 15 years.
However, it seems people are reconsidering this once outmoded type of flooring – especially as the advent of new technology means homeowners are able to customise their carpets.
"You can now get designs put into wall-to-wall carpets in the way that you want them; you don’t just have to go into a shop and get a plain carpet or the patterned carpet that is in the shop," she explains.
This means that we can now pick our patterns and colours – a tempting thought indeed for those who long for a truly unique interior design.
For those of us who prefer to follow the latest trends in carpet design, products to look out for this spring and summer include those with delicate floral patterns, stripes and blue-green shades inspired by the Art Deco movement, according to the Carpet Foundation.
